FINAL DRIVE

REAR DRIVE SHAFT

Drive Shaft Removal

1. Raise and support the vehicle.
CAUTION
Serious injury may result if machine tips or falls. Be
sure machine is secure before beginning this
procedure. Always wear eye protection.
2. Remove the four wheel nuts and rear wheel.
3. Remove the cotter pin (Item 1) and loosen the rear
wheel hub castle nut (Item 2). Remove the nut, and
(2) cone washers (Item 3) from the rear wheel hub
assembly.
4. Remove the two bolts (Item 4) retaining the upper
and lower radius rods to the bearing carrier. Discard
the nuts. Let the radius rods swing downward.
5. Remove the brake caliper mounting bolts (Item 5).
Remove the rear brake caliper assembly.
6. CAUTION: Do not hang the caliper by the brake line.
Use wire to hang caliper to prevent damage to the
brake line.

7. Remove the rear hub assembly from the bearing
carrier.
8. Support the trailing arm from underneath.
9. Remove the lower shock mounting bolt and nut (Item
6). Swing the shock inward. Discard the nut.
10. Remove the stabilizer bar mounting bolt, washer and
nut (Item 7). Discard the nut.
11. Lift the trailing arm assembly upward so the rear
drive shaft is parallel with the ground.
12. Leaving the drive shaft in the transmission, swing the
rear trailing arm assembly outward until it is free from
the rear drive shaft.
13. Lower the trailing arm.
14. With a short, sharp jerk, remove drive shaft from the
transmission splines.
